What is PPC?
PPC, or Pay-Per-Click, is a type of online advertising that allows you to display your ads on search engines and social media platforms. The beauty of PPC is that you only pay when someone clicks on your ad. Imagine placing a sign outside your business that only costs you money when someone actually walks in and asks for your services—that’s essentially how PPC works.
With PPC, you can choose specific keywords that potential customers are likely to use when searching for pest control services in Bradenton. When someone types those keywords into Google, your ad can appear at the top of the search results. This means you’re more likely to be seen by people who need your services, leading to more calls and, ultimately, more customers.
Why is PPC Essential for Small Businesses in Bradenton?
-
Immediate Results: Unlike organic search engine optimization (SEO), which can take months to yield results, PPC campaigns can start driving traffic to your website almost instantly. As soon as your campaign is live, your ad can be seen by customers searching for pest control in your area.
-
Targeted Advertising: PPC allows you to target specific demographics and geographic areas. For a Bradenton pest control service, you can ensure your ads are only shown to local homeowners or businesses. This targeted approach increases the likelihood of converting clicks into customers.
-
Budget Control: With PPC, you can set a budget that works for you. Whether you have a small or large amount to spend, you can control how much you pay daily. Plus, you can adjust your budget as you see which ads are performing well.
-
Tracking Performance: One of the significant benefits of PPC is the ability to track your results. You can see how many clicks your ad received, how many led to calls and conversions, and where your customers are coming from. This information helps you optimize your campaigns for better performance.

FAQs About PPC for Pest Control Services
1. How much should I budget for PPC?
- Your budget can vary widely based on the keywords you choose. For a local pest control service, starting with a budget of $10-$50 a day can help you see results. Monitor performance and adjust accordingly.
2. How can I choose the right keywords?
- Think about what potential customers would type into Google when looking for pest control services. Use tools like Google’s Keyword Planner to see popular search terms in your area.
3. Can I run PPC ads on my own?

4. How long does it take to see results?
- With PPC, you can start seeing results almost immediately after your campaign goes live. However, it’s important to give it time and continually optimize your ads for the best performance.
5. What if my ads are not getting clicks?
- If your ads are not performing well, it could be due to various factors such as ad copy, choice of keywords, or even your budget. Regularly analyzing and tweaking your ads can help improve their performance.
